PRODUCT NAME: VAX PrintServer Client Software, SSA 27.67.04-A Version 3.0 HARDWARE REQUIREMENTS Processors Supported VAX: VAX 6210, VAX 6220, VAX 6230, VAX 6240, VAX 6310, VAX 6320, VAX 6330, VAX 6333, VAX 6340, VAX 6350, VAX 6360, VAX 8200, VAX 8250, VAX 8300, VAX 8350, VAX 8500, VAX 8530, VAX 8550, VAX 8600, VAX 8650, VAX 8700, VAX 8800, VAX 8810, VAX 8820, VAX 8830, VAX 8840, VAX 8842, VAX 8974, VAX 8978 VAX-11/750, VAX-11/780, VAX-11/782, VAX-11/785 MicroVAX: MicroVAX II, MicroVAX 2000, MicroVAX 3300/3400, MicroVAX 3500/3600, MicroVAX 3800/3900 VAXstation: VAXstation II, VAXstation 2000, VAXstation 3100, VAXstation 3200/3500, VAXstation 3520/3540, VAXstation 8000 VAXserver: VAXserver 3300/3400/3500/3600, VAXserver 6310/6320, VAXserver 3800/3900 Not Supported: MicroVAX I, VAXstation I, VAX 11/725 Processor Restrictions The VAX-11/782 processor is not supported by VMS Operating System V5.x. The PrintServer Client software runs on the following VAX hardware: Any valid VAX minimum system configuration with: ^ 2 megabytes of memory ^ DELUA or DEUNA or DEBNT Ethernet Controller Interface ^ 1600 BPI Tape drive, or TK50 tape drive ^ System disk Any valid MicroVAX or VAXstation system configuration with: ^ Minimum of two megabytes of memory ^ DEQNA or DELQA Ethernet Controller Interface ^ A TK50 tape drive ^ RD52, RD53 or RD54 system disk The PrintServer Client software requires that a minimum of one PrintServer (a PrintServer 20, a PrintServer 40, or a PrintServer 40 Plus) is connected to the Ethernet physical channel with a transceiver cable and either an Ethernet transceiver (H4000) or the Local Network Interconnect (DELNI) or the ThinWire Ethernet Station Adapter (DESTA). Block Space Requirements (Block Cluster Size = 1): Disk space required for installation: 3500 blocks (3.28M bytes) Disk space required for use (permanent): 2700 blocks (1.38M bytes) These counts refer to the disk space required on the system disk. The sizes are approximations; actual sizes may vary depending on the user's system environment, configuration and software options selected. OPTIONAL HARDWARE Additional PrintServers may be connected to the Ethernet physical channel. VAXCLUSTER ENVIRONMENT This layered product is fully supported when installed on any valid and licensed VAXcluster* configuration without restrictions. The HARDWARE REQUIREMENTS sections of this product's Software Product Description and System Support Addendum detail any special hardware required by this product. * V5.x VAXcluster configurations are fully described in the VAXcluster Software Product Description (29.78.xx) and include CI, Ethernet, and Mixed Interconnect configurations. SOFTWARE REQUIREMENTS VMS Operating System V4.7, V5.0, V5.1, or V5.2 MicroVMS Operating System V4.7 DECnet-VAX V5.0, V5.1 or V5.2 VAX PrintServer Supporting Host Software V3.1 installed on one system on the same Ethernet. VMS Tailoring For VMS V5.x systems, the following classes of VMS are required for full functionality of this layered product: ^ VMS Required Saveset ^ Network Support ^ System Programming Support ^ Secure User's Environment ^ Utilities For more information on VMS classes and tailoring, refer to the VMS Operating System Software Product Description (SPD 25.01.xx) MicroVMS Tailoring For MicroVMS V4.7 systems, the following are required for full functionality of this layered product: ^ Base System ^ Program Development For more information on MicroVMS components, refer to the MicroVMS Operating System Software Product Description. OPTIONAL SOFTWARE None GROWTH CONSIDERATIONS The minimum hardware/software requirements for any future version of this product may be different from the minimum requirements for the current version.
